Table des matières:
Introduction
La réalité augmentée collaborative (RA collaborative) transforme la manière dont les utilisateurs interagissent avec le contenu en ligne. En 2026, intégrer des fonctionnalités de réalité augmentée collaborative dans les sites web devient un atout concurrentiel majeur, permettant de créer des expériences immersives partagées en temps réel. Cet article vous guide à travers les technologies, les étapes d’intégration, les défis et les bonnes pratiques pour réussir cette intégration.
Qu’est-ce que la réalité augmentée collaborative ?
La réalité augmentée collaborative combine la superposition d’éléments virtuels sur le monde réel avec la possibilité pour plusieurs utilisateurs d’interagir simultanément dans un même espace augmenté. Contrairement à la RA individuelle, elle favorise le travail d’équipe, les jeux multijoueurs, les visites virtuelles partagées ou les formations à distance. En 2026, les sites web peuvent tirer parti de cette technologie pour offrir des expériences sociales et engageantes.
Pourquoi intégrer la RA collaborative dans votre site web ?
- Engagement utilisateur accru : Les expériences partagées augmentent le temps passé sur le site et la fidélisation.
- Avantage concurrentiel : Peu de sites proposent encore cette fonctionnalité, vous démarquant ainsi.
- Applications variées : E-commerce, éducation, tourisme, design d’intérieur, etc.
- Innovation technologique : Montre que votre marque est à la pointe.
Technologies clés pour la RA collaborative en 2026
WebXR et WebRTC
WebXR est la norme pour les expériences de réalité virtuelle et augmentée sur le web. Combiné à WebRTC pour la communication en temps réel, il permet de synchroniser les états des objets virtuels entre les utilisateurs. En 2026, ces API sont largement supportées par les navigateurs modernes.
Frameworks et bibliothèques
- Three.js : pour le rendu 3D côté client.
- AR.js : pour la détection de marqueurs et le suivi.
- Socket.io : pour la communication bidirectionnelle en temps réel.
- WebAssembly : pour des performances élevées dans le calcul des interactions.
Infrastructure cloud et edge computing
Les services cloud comme AWS ou Google Cloud offrent des solutions pour héberger les sessions collaboratives, tandis que l’edge computing réduit la latence en traitant les données au plus près des utilisateurs.
Étapes pour intégrer la RA collaborative dans votre site web
1. Définir les cas d’usage
Identifiez les scénarios où la RA collaborative apporte une valeur ajoutée : essai de meubles à plusieurs, visites guidées de musée en groupe, formation technique à distance.
2. Choisir la stack technologique
Sélectionnez les outils adaptés à votre projet. Par exemple, Three.js + AR.js + Socket.io pour un prototype rapide, ou un framework plus complet comme A-Frame avec Networked-Aframe pour des applications plus complexes.
3. Développer le backend collaboratif
Mettez en place un serveur gérant les états partagés (position, rotation, échelle des objets) et les événements utilisateurs. Utilisez des protocoles comme WebSockets pour une synchronisation temps réel.
4. Implémenter la détection et le suivi
Pour la RA, le suivi peut être basé sur des marqueurs (QR codes) ou sans marqueur (SLAM). En 2026, les algorithmes de suivi visuel sont très performants même sur des appareils mobiles.
5. Optimiser les performances
Minimisez la bande passante en compressant les données 3D, utilisez le lazy loading et les CDN. Testez sur différents appareils pour garantir une expérience fluide.
6. Tester et itérer
Organisez des tests utilisateurs pour valider l’ergonomie et la synchronisation. Ajustez en fonction des retours.
Défis et solutions
Latence et synchronisation
La latence peut ruiner l’expérience collaborative. Utilisez des serveurs régionaux, le protocole QUIC, et des algorithmes de prédiction pour compenser les délais.
Compatibilité navigateur
Tous les navigateurs ne supportent pas encore WebXR. Prévoyez une dégradation élégante avec une version non-RA pour les utilisateurs non compatibles.
Confidentialité et sécurité
Les données des caméras et les interactions doivent être protégées. Utilisez HTTPS, chiffrez les flux WebRTC et respectez le RGPD.
Bonnes pratiques pour 2026
- Conception centrée utilisateur : Simplifiez l’interface, guidez les utilisateurs pour la configuration initiale.
- Accessibilité : Proposez des alternatives pour les personnes handicapées (ex : description audio).
- Analyse des données : Collectez des métriques sur l’utilisation pour améliorer l’expérience.
- Mise à jour continue : Suivez les évolutions des API WebXR et des frameworks.
Exemples concrets d’intégration
E-commerce : essayage de vêtements en groupe
Des amis peuvent essayer virtuellement des vêtements et donner leur avis en temps réel depuis le site.
Éducation : dissection virtuelle collaborative
Des étudiants dissèquent un modèle 3D ensemble, chacun voyant les actions des autres.
Tourisme : visite guidée augmentée
Un guide virtuel apparaît dans l’environnement réel des visiteurs, qui peuvent interagir entre eux.
Conclusion
Intégrer des fonctionnalités de réalité augmentée collaborative dans les sites web en 2026 est un processus complexe mais extrêmement gratifiant. En choisissant les bonnes technologies, en suivant une méthodologie rigoureuse et en anticipant les défis, vous pouvez offrir des expériences immersives et sociales qui captiveront vos utilisateurs. N’attendez plus pour explorer le potentiel de la RA collaborative et faire de votre site un pionnier de l’interaction en ligne.
Photo by Huy Nguyen on Pexels
